Web13 apr. 2024 · For each part of a path, after you type enough letters to distinguish the name of the directory from the others, press Tab to auto-complete the directory name. For example, type the following on the command line: cd /usr/lib/fire. Now, press Tab and the shell will fill in the rest of the “firefox” directory for you. WebGo back to previous directory in shell How can I change to the previous directory instead of going up? is there a command line way to navigate back to the directory I was in? I … Web1 mei 2024 · The command cd - will allow you to quickly return to the last directory. You may also be interested in the pushd and popd commands which allow even more control over your directory navigation. It’s so easy to copy files and folders directly in the Linux terminal that sometimes it can replace conventional file managers. To use the cp command, just type it along with the source and destination files: cp file_to_copy.txt new_file.txt camping hiking cookware backpacking cookingWeb14 apr. 2024 · Surface Studio vs iMac – Which Should You Pick? 5 Ways to Connect Wireless Headphones to TV.
